I have a 2165 mower and i had pto clutch issues. It would just disenguage and after pressing in the switch and pulling it back out, it would run for a minute or so but still quit. I bought a switch and this did not fix it. I replaced the relay. Local mower shop suggested to adjust the clutch. I did, but that is not the problem. I checked voltage @ the clutch connector, and i have voltage, but no ground. Ground is the blue wire and it runs directly to the switch. The way it is wired, i do not understand how the relay is involved, or even if it is. As i turn on the ignition switch, the relay is closed. It does not matter if the pto switch is on or off.
